Almost all children expect their parents to give them more pocket money. But most of the time, their parents just give them a certain amount(数量). And the amount of money that children get from their family is different from family to family. The frequency(频率) of getting money is different, too. Some children get pocket money every week. Others get pocket money every month. Do you know why
First of all, parents expect children to choose between the spending and the saving. Then children should understand what their parents expect them to buy with their pocket money. Usually, some children spend all of the money soon after they get it. Experts usually advise parents not to offer more money until it is the right time. By doing this, children will learn to spend money well.
In order to encourage children to do the housework, some parents pay children for doing that. However, some experts don’t agree because helping at home is a normal part of family life.
Pocket money can give children a chance(机会) to experience three things. They can spend it by giving it to a good course. They can spend it by buying things they want. They can save it for future use. Saving money helps children understand that money never comes easily. Saving money can also open the door to a better future for children.

As middle school students, it’s very important for us to be independent. What should we do to become independent First, let’s begin with our own things. It’s our job to clean our own rooms and make our beds. Second, help with housework. We can help cook or clean the house in our free time. Doing housework teaches us how to look after ourselves. Third, learn actively. We should learn by ourselves and finish our homework on time. Finally, think about things by ourselves. We sometimes need to make plans or decisions alone. Don’t always depend on others.
I think if we keep on doing these, we’ll become more and more independent.(77 words) Section B (2a—2e)
